Big Agnes Sidewinder SL
Best sleeping bag for side sleepers seeking comfort and warmth.
Engineered for those who toss and turn, this bag features a unique shape that moves with you rather than restricting you. It balances warmth and weight by mapping synthetic insulation in high-pressure areas while keeping premium down where it counts most.

Who it's for
- Side sleepers seeking ergonomic comfort and freedom of movement
- Backpackers prioritizing low weight and compact gear
- Hikers camping in humid or unpredictable weather conditions
Who should skip it
- Back or stomach sleepers who prefer a traditional bag shape
- Budget-conscious campers looking for an entry-level sleeping bag
- Campers wanting low-maintenance, wash-and-go gear
Performance breakdown
Side-sleeping ergonomics
The specialized footbox and fit perfectly accommodate natural side-sleeping positions.
Thermal efficiency
Body-mapped insulation zones effectively trap heat exactly where you need it.
Pillow stability
The integrated Pillow Barn keeps your head support secure all night.
Zipper performance
Anti-snag locking mechanism ensures smooth entry and exit in the dark.
Moisture resistance
Water-repellent down and PFC-free finish handle damp conditions with ease.
Mobility and fit
Technical cut allows natural movement without feeling restricted or claustrophobic.
Key Specs
Temperature Rating
20 degrees Fahrenheit
Weight
2.25 lbs
Fill Power
650 cubic inches per ounce
Sleeping Bag Shape
Mummy
Insulation Type
650-fill DownTek and FireLine ECO Synthetic
Shell Material
Nylon ripstop
Lining Material
Polyester taffeta
Max User Height
72 inches
Zipper Location
Ambidextrous
Water Resistant
Yes
